Description

The Order Tip for WooCommerce WordPress plugin before 1.6.0 does not check the capability of the user requesting a file deletion, nor does it restrict which path may be deleted, allowing users with the Shop Manager role and above to delete arbitrary files on the server, which could lead to the site being taken over.

Executive Summary

This vulnerability affects the Order Tip for WooCommerce WordPress plugin before version 1.6.0. It allows users with the Shop Manager role or higher to delete arbitrary files on the server due to missing capability checks and path restrictions in the delete_exported_csv_file_ajax function. This could lead to a complete site takeover.

Detection Guidance

Check if the 'Order Tip for WooCommerce' plugin version is below 1.6.0. Inspect server logs for suspicious file deletion requests from users with Shop Manager role or higher. Look for AJAX calls to 'delete_exported_csv_file_ajax' function.

Impact Analysis

An attacker with Shop Manager privileges or higher could delete critical files on the server, potentially causing the website to crash or be taken over. This includes deleting configuration files, plugins, or core WordPress files, leading to full system compromise.

Mitigation Strategies

Update the 'Order Tip for WooCommerce' plugin to version 1.6.0 or later immediately. Remove unnecessary user roles with Shop Manager capabilities. Monitor server file system for unauthorized changes.
